You people are missing the flaw with using torture during interrogation. Sure, it can be used against terrorists, but there is the chance that they might catch an innocent person for whatever reason (military and the government can f*** up, too), torture said person, and said person ends up confessing to whatever the interrogators were questioning him / her about.
